    That GT3 was used (5000 km) but a factory owned (registered to Porsche) car. Some German dealers sometimes get these cars to sell them. I think the new price was basically the "old" price. Basically, this car costed used and with 5000 km the same it costed new. Price was 166k, I got an offer for 160k. 

    Yes, even the 991 GT3 (without RS) seems to keep a good value but I already have a 911, even if it isn't a GT3 and I really put my heart on an "old" 2013/2014 R8 V10 Plus. These cars are heavily underrated and almost cheap, considering that most are selling now for around 100k EUR but had a new car price tag of 180k and more.
